FILE - Buffalo Bills defensive tackle Gable Steveson (61) participates in a drill during NFL football practice in Orchard Park, N.Y., Tuesday, June 4, 2024. U.S. wrestler Gable Steveson thought he accomplished the impossible with his stunning last-second takedown to win a gold medal at the 2021 Tokyo Games. Three years later, the 24-year-old Steveson is raising the degree of difficulty in approaching his next challenge: The NFL. (AP Photo/Jeffrey T. Barnes, File)
